The Moon takes 27.3 days to go around the Earth once, but the time from new moon to new moon is 29.5 days. This is because while the Moon is going around the Earth, the Earth keeps moving going around the Sun. By the time the Moon has made exactly one orbit, the Earth has moved another 27.3 days along in its orbit, and it takes the Moon another 2.2 days to get back into the same relative arrangement of Sun-Moon-Earth.

The Moon is not necessarily located between the Sun and Earth.About half of the time (half of the orbit of the Moon around Earth), the Earth is closer to the Sun than the Moon is. This is the case whenever the Moon surface is more than 50 % lit (more than half moon).At full moon, the Earth is located almost on a straight line between the Moon and the Sun.At some full moons, there is a lunar eclipse, where the Earth is located so close to a straight line between the Moon and the Sun and that the Earth casts shadow on the Moon.Similarly, half of the time (half of the orbit of the Moon around Earth), the Moon is closer to the Sun than the Earth is. This is the case whenever the Moon surface is less than 50 % lit (less than half moon).At new moon, the Moon is located almost on a straight line between the Sun and Earth.At some new moons, there is a solar eclipse, where the Moon is so close to being on a straight line betwen the Sun and Earth that the Moon covers the Sun when seen from the Earth.But the distance from the Moon to Earth is always much less than the distance from the Moon to the Sun. This is because the Moon orbits Earth in almost a circle with an average radius of 385,000 kilometers, whereas Earth (and with it, the Moon) orbits the Sun in almost a circle with an average radius of 150,000,000 kilometers.The Sun is always around 400 times as far from Earth as the Moon is.

The earth moves faster than the moon. Answer 2 Since they both take the same time to get round the Sun (1 year) they must both move at the same average speed. However, the Moon is also moving round the Earth. Unless its plane of rotation is at exactly 90 degrees to the path of the Earth around the Sun (which it isn't), there will be times when it's going around the Sun slightly faster than Earth and times when it's going slightly slower.

No, the moon does not spin faster than the Earth, it actually spins much more slowly than the Earth does, just once per lunar month, keeping the same face pointed at the Earth at all times.
